Reports: Opening night of Charlie Sheen tour bombs
News reports indicate that the opening night of Charlie Sheen's live tour tonight, on a scale of 1 to 10 men, wouldn't even get 2 1/2.
"The 70-minute show hadn't even ended when the first reviews were in," wrote The Associated Press, "and they were brutal."
EW.com's James Hibberd live-blogged the event, chronciling how the heady anticipation (illustrated by the image above that Sheen tweeted) dissolved into a cascade of wide-eyed disappointment and boos.
"The show is now an unmitigated disaster," Hibberd writes. "People are leaving early. Attendee Chris Acchione, who came all the way from Toronto for the show, says, 'He’s making a fool of himself. Is there a bigger loser in the world? He’ll be [begging] Chuck Lorre for his job back by the end of the week.' ”
That's probably not the case, but it's not looking too promising for Chicago, the next stop on the tour Sunday.
